The Margate Music Man. The Real Thing - Music Not Muzak! Wednesday, 30 September 2009. Chas and Dave: The Classic Albums and Beyond! I first heard Chas and Dave back in ’78 when they had their first (minor) hit with ‘Strummin’. At the time I thought of them as being very similar to other cockney post-punk acts such as Ian Dury, Squeeze and The Street Band (remember ‘Toast’? The Margate Music Man. The Real Thing - Music Not Muzak! Sunday, 13 June 2010. Linda Gail Lewis: Sessionography and Discography, 1960 - 2010. Is much more than just the younger sister of Jerry Lee Lewis. A talented singer, songwriter and musician in her own right, she has recorded and toured with such musicians as Van Morrison. The Margate Music Man. The Real Thing - Music Not Muzak! Monday, 12 October 2009. Paul McCartney: The U.K. Singles, 1971 to 2007. It's difficult to think of another major artist whose work has been as inconsistent as the post-Beatles career of Paul McCartney, someone whose music has varied from the awe-inspiring to the downright embarrassing to the truly forgettable.
